Abderrahman Slaoui Museum: A Journey into the Riches of Moroccan Art and Culture

Morocco, a land known for its rich history, vibrant culture, and breathtaking beauty, holds a treasure trove of artistic wonders. Situated in the heart of Casablanca, the Abderrahman Slaoui Museum stands as a testament to the artistic vision and passion of its namesake, Abderrahman Slaoui, a renowned Moroccan businessman and art collector. This captivating museum offers visitors a profound journey into the captivating tapestry of Moroccan art and culture.

A Tribute to Moroccan Jewelry

The museum’s permanent collection includes a stunning display of 18th- and 19th-century Moroccan gold jewelry, a testament to the exquisite craftsmanship of the past. These rare jewelry pieces, meticulously preserved by Abderrahman Slaoui and his father-in-law, pay homage to the rich tradition of adorning oneself with gold during special occasions, such as weddings. Among the highlighted pieces is the iconic Khamsa, or hand of Fatima, a symbol revered in both Jewish and Arab cultures for its protective properties against the evil eye.

Exploring the Beauty of Berber Jewelry

In contrast to gold jewelry, the museum also displays the intricate beauty of Amazigh, or Berber, jewelry. Traditionally crafted from silver and often adorned with enamel, coral, or amber, these jewelry sets were worn by Amazigh women in their daily lives. A reflection of the Berber culture’s symbology, each piece tells a unique story, with different shapes and colors representing various tribal groups. The choice of silver, symbolizing purity, emphasizes the importance of these women as protectors of culture and knowledge within their communities.

Celebrating the Legacy of Muhammad Ben Ali Ribati

Muhammad Ben Ali Ribati, one of Morocco’s pioneering modern painters, holds a special place within the walls of the museum. His captivating figurative paintings depict scenes from Tangier’s Kasbah and its inhabitants, offering a glimpse into Morocco’s vibrant street life. Ribati’s career flourished with the support of Sir John Lavery, an artist from the royal court of England, who recognized his artistic talent. Together, they journeyed to England, where Ribati’s works were exhibited, further solidifying his place in Moroccan art history.

A Glimpse into the Orientalist Era

The Abderrahman Slaoui Museum proudly preserves a vast collection of Orientalist posters dating back to the late 19th century. Commissioned from esteemed orientalist painters, including Jacques Majorelle, Charles Halo, and Joseph de la Nézière, these posters showcase the allure of Moroccan, Algerian, and Tunisian landscapes. Created to promote travel and exotic destinations, these posters capture the essence of a bygone era. The museum offers a glimpse into this captivating chapter of Moroccan history, showcasing select posters alongside a comprehensive collection featured in the book “The Orientalist Poster” (1998).

Embracing Tradition and Nurturing Innovation

What sets the Abderrahman Slaoui Museum apart is not only its commitment to preserving Moroccan art’s rich heritage but also its dedication to fostering contemporary innovation. Moreover, the museum hosts quarterly exhibitions featuring contemporary Moroccan artists, providing a platform for emerging talents to shine. Additionally, it offers artistic workshops, allowing visitors to immerse themselves in the traditional crafts and techniques that have shaped Morocco’s artistic legacy.
